Yes, you can absolutely carry luggage on Swiss trains in 2026, and the system is designed to be exceptionally accommodating for travelers with bags. Most trains feature dedicated luggage racks near the doors for large suitcases, as well as overhead racks for smaller items like backpacks. Additionally, space between seat backrests (arranged back-to-back) is often used for medium-sized bags. In 2026, Swiss Federal Railways (SBB) also offers premium door-to-door luggage services, where your bags are collected from your hotel and delivered to your next destination for a fee, allowing you to travel "hands-free." If you are handling your own bags, it is important to ensure they do not block aisles or occupy seats, especially during peak commute hours. For those on a multi-city tour, almost all major Swiss stations provide lockers of various sizes, ranging from small to "jumbo," which can be paid for via a mobile app or contactless card, making short-term storage seamless.
